Pool and spa chemistry levels
What each reading should be
- Free chlorine
- 1–10 ppm Florida 64E-9.004
- pH
- 7.2–7.8 pH COMAR 10.17.01.45
- Total alkalinity
- 60–180 ppm COMAR 10.17.01.45
- Calcium hardness
- 150–400 ppm COMAR 10.17.01.45
- Stabiliser
- up to 100 ppm Florida 64E-9.004
Every band, and who sets it
A pool
| Reading | Range | Ideal |
|---|---|---|
| Free chlorine Florida 64E-9.004 (1)(d)2 |
1–10 ppm | 2–4 |
| pH COMAR 10.17.01.45 A(1) |
7.2–7.8 pH | 7.4–7.6 |
| pH Florida 64E-9.004 (1)(d)1 |
7.0–7.8 pH | none stated |
| Total alkalinity COMAR 10.17.01.45 A(2) |
60–180 ppm | 80–120 |
| Calcium hardness COMAR 10.17.01.45 A(3) |
150–400 ppm | 200–400 |
| Stabiliser Florida 64E-9.004 (1)(d)4 |
up to 100 ppm | 30–50 |
| Saturation index COMAR 10.17.01.45 |
-0.5–0.5 index | none stated |
A stabilised pool
| Reading | Range | Ideal |
|---|---|---|
| Free chlorine CDC Healthy Swimming |
2 and up ppm | none stated |
An indoor pool
| Reading | Range | Ideal |
|---|---|---|
| Free chlorine Florida 64E-9.004 (1)(d)2 |
up to 5 ppm | none stated |
A salt water pool
| Reading | Range | Ideal |
|---|---|---|
| Dissolved solids COMAR 10.17.01.45 A(5) |
up to 3,000 ppm | none stated |
A spa or hot tub
| Reading | Range | Ideal |
|---|---|---|
| pH COMAR 10.17.01.45 A(1) |
7.2–7.8 pH | none stated |
| Free chlorine Florida 64E-9.004 (1)(d)2 |
2–5 ppm | none stated |
| Total alkalinity COMAR 10.17.01.45 A(2) |
60–180 ppm | none stated |
| Calcium hardness COMAR 10.17.01.45 A(3) |
150–400 ppm | none stated |
| Stabiliser Florida 64E-9.004 (1)(d)4 |
up to 40 ppm | none stated |
| Water temperature COMAR 10.17.01.45 C(2) |
up to 104 °F | none stated |
Pool and spa rules are adopted and amended state by state, and most of the ranges here are written for public pools. Confirm every figure against the code your jurisdiction has adopted and against your own product label.

Should I balance pH or alkalinity first?
Alkalinity first. It buffers pH, so a pH you correct before the alkalinity will move again when the alkalinity does. Add one thing at a time and test again before the next.
